Swift water rescue technicians successfully located and retrieved a person stranded by flood water south of Toowoomba.
Four Queensland Fire and Emergency Services crews were called to the incident about 11.20am, as Back Creek swelled with floodwater at Hirstglen.
The swift water crew used an inflatable dinghy to rescue the person from an area that was inaccessible by foot or by vehicle.
The person was uninjured.
